Hang your clothes out on a clothes line the way your grandmother used to. You’ll save energy and you’ll be surprised how fast clothes will dry on a sunny day.
If you have pollen allergies and can’t leave your clothes out to dry, hang them on the shower rod, or get an indoor drying rack.
If you do use your electric or gas dryer to dry your laundry, follow these tips from NRDC:
- Clean the lint filter in the dryer after each use.
- Dry heavy and light fabrics separately
- Don’t add wet items to a load that’s already partly dry.
- If available, use the moisture sensor setting.
